What Is Enterprise Utility Integration Eai?
Today, enterprise application integration and enterprise service bus (ESB) are mixed to form an integration platform as a service (iPaaS). With EAI, you can join your purposes and let data move between them—effectively eradicating existing knowledge silos and stopping any from forming sooner or later. The ESB performs an necessary position in coordination, integration, routing, and monitoring enterprise operations. On the other hand, microservices concentrate on creating a single software with a set of small companies. Nevertheless, microservices and ESB are perfectly suitable, they usually can both complement each other. This can additionally be a significant limitation of the bus mannequin; the system is a single level of failure because of its central configuration.
These recipes play a prominent function in enterprise application integration by automating the entire course of. The major aims of EAI are to facilitate seamless data move, enhance real-time information entry, remove operational silos, and enable scalable integrations amongst different enterprise functions. Binmile supplies a set of enterprise application integration options designed to fulfill varied enterprise needs. Whether you want to join on-premise systems with cloud applications, make certain of cross-platform compatibility, or facilitate B2B integration, Binmile has the specialization and sources to make it occur smoothly. One of the principle the cause why departmental productiveness will get decreased is juggling a number of software tools.
Enterprise Software Integration – Connecting Companies Digitally
In this article, we are going to discover its core mechanisms, models, and what a successful EAI project and tips on how to measure them. Understanding EAI’s fundamentals equips organizations to harness its potential, driving innovation and sustaining a aggressive edge in the dynamic global market. Microservices is one other flexible architecture that extends SOA by decreasing service dependencies even further. In a typical SOA, an individual service may embody multiple enterprise functionalities or domains that serve broad functions for different shoppers. Companies also share databases and other sources, making them much less flexible and more durable to scale individually.
Increasing investments in enterprise application incorporation solutions are contributing to aggressive development out there. Businesses are assigning more sources to improve their integration abilities, streamline processes, and enhance general effectivity. EAI seeks to unite multilateral processes to construct a unified system to hold out operations effectively.
E.g. one software can have help for SOAP net services whereas one other software could be supporting only EMS/JMS based mostly communication. One have to execute all these steps to find a way to successfully combine totally different purposes in any enterprise. As acknowledged earlier, the term EAI refers to a set of rules and methodologies for utility integration; EAI is divided into numerous layers in a stack.
This permits for real-time visibility into the provision chain, main to higher inventory management and decision-making. Enterprise Utility Integration modernizes legacy methods with the newest applied sciences and new applications. EAI ensures knowledge consistency throughout all techniques to ease compliance with regulatory necessities. The group is led by people who performed a key function in constructing integration merchandise at corporations like TIBCO, Salesforce, and Oracle Fusion Middleware. These leaders aren’t just motivated to innovate additional at Workato, but they’re uniquely positioned to do so eai application integration successfully. However it doesn’t rework entire financial, marketing, IT, and HR processes end-to-end.
What Is Customer Information Integration (cdi)?
By combining these parts, you’ll be capable of clearly show the positive influence of your EAI project on your group. Small, independent companies that communicate through APIs supply high scalability and flexibility in integration. Good for organizations seeking agility and scalability, enabling impartial deployment and scaling of components to assist https://www.globalcloudteam.com/ CI/CD processes. Software Program that acts as an middleman layer to allow integration and communication between totally different applications. Best for integrating applications with incompatible protocols or data formats, middleware enables seamless integration by abstracting these differences.
- Enterprise applications may be hosted on-premises within the organization’s personal data centers.
- Some enterprise organizations have migrated their applications to public cloud environments.
- This frees up time on your BT team (which they can reallocate in path of more important tasks), and it permits strains of business to see value out of your integrations and automations sooner.
- Most organizations rely on quite a few functions and services of their day-to-day operations.
- Middleware is software program that operates between an application’s person interface and an operating system of a computer.
The Challenges Of Enterprise Utility Integration And The Method To Overcome Them
This mode is fast, trustworthy, and doesn’t cost a lot for dealing with minimal components. The earliest utility integrations had been carried out using point-to-point connections. A script can be used to extract knowledge from one software, modify its structure or format, and send it to a different application. These inefficiencies may result in poor access to data, administrative delays, and slower business processes.
It is also important to supply coaching and assist to ensure the full capabilities of the integrated functions are used. EAI permits functions to trade knowledge in order that modifications in one utility are instantaneously shared throughout all built-in systems. It provides stakeholders with probably the most current information for well timed decision-making. Implementing Enterprise Utility Integration solutions can pose challenges corresponding to compatibility issues, knowledge safety issues, and the complexity of integrating legacy methods. Ensuring that totally different applications can communicate seamlessly requires careful planning and often necessitates updates to present infrastructure.
If you combine the platform with the apps your customer-facing teams use—allowing these groups to access the product usage information in their apps—, every team is likely to make use of the insights in ways in which help their targets. For example, support groups can leverage the information to raised identify the shoppers who are vulnerable to churning, whereas account managers can spot shoppers who are ripe for up-selling or cross-selling. As your group adopts more applications over time—as most businesses proceed to do—, you may discover that many provide information that’s valuable for a number of teams.
Additionally, adopting middle-layer components like API gateways creates consistency and predictability in interactions between totally different techniques. You want to ensure data governance in your EAI techniques as knowledge moves across your architectural mannequin. A complete safety technique covers all integration elements, from communication endpoints to network and knowledge storage. For example, you can implement sturdy authentication and authorization mechanisms to ensure that solely authorized customers and methods can access and carry out information operations. Data encryption at rest and transit is a should to meet regulatory compliance standards.
Information mapping is the method of matching knowledge fields throughout different systems to make sure consistency. For example, you can map the shopper ID in the CRM system with the shopper quantity within the ERP system to enhance service supply. You can schedule projects, assign duties, monitor progress, and embody monetary reporting modules in one place.
Effective enterprise application integration is decided by the uninterrupted move of information between systems. Binmile’s integration solutions ensure that Limitations of AI data strikes painlessly, without roadblocks or bottlenecks, encouraging an agile & data-driven methodology. Name it a connective touch point, regulating data between the methods and interfaces.
Built-in databases and workflows automatically direct customer inquiries to the corresponding department, helping clients reach the right individual easily. Middleware is software program that operates between an application’s consumer interface and an operating system of a pc. In the context of enterprise utility integration, middleware acts as an intermediary that facilitates information translation and exchange between distributed purposes. Firms can deploy various sorts of middleware, similar to application server or database middleware. An EAI platform operates like a type of middleware that connects the disparate techniques collectively.